Code A044 - Left Front Channel Will Not Move: Notes
This test is designed to detect bound-up ESB, a stuck motor or seized hydraulic modulator during initialization. When release is commanded during initialization, ESB should release motor, resulting in sensed current being less than commanded current (motor is spinning freely). If motor is not moving, sensed current will be equal to stalled current. Code A044 will set if EBCM detects motor cannot be moved in either direction. Code A044 will disable ABS function and turn ABS warning light on.
NOTE:
Test numbers refer to numbers on diagnostic chart.
- Checks if motor wire terminals are in proper connector cavities.
- This step checks motor movement from Tech 1 commands.
- This step compares EBCM command and motor feedback current.
- This step checks for hydraulic modulator gear and piston movement.
- This step verifies motor can be applied when commanded.
- This step determines if code is caused by defective EBCM.
